The Polish government has earmarked 12.5 billion złoty for air quality and climate initiatives next year, a notable increase from prior allocations. Local authorities acknowledge the funding boost but stress that environmental challenges are growing, suggesting the sum may still fall short of needs. This signals continued fiscal commitment to climate policy amid rising pressure.
